VP9800 Series Fully Convergent Media Engine
Huawei VP9800 series MCUs are next-generation universal transcoding MCUs that feature large capacity, high cost-effectiveness, flexible port allocation, and smooth capacity expansion. The MCUs provide industry 1080p60 full encoding and decoding capabilities and integrates the advantage of the SFU architecture, to provides access to a large number of participants, and integrates audio, video, presentation, and data to enable seamless communication and collaboration.

Specifications
Model | VP9830A | VP9850 | VP9860 |
AVC Ports |
12 x 1080p 60 fps 25 x 1080p 30 fps 50 x 720p 100 x SD |
25 x 1080p 60 fps 50 x 1080p 30 fps 100 x 720p 200 x SD |
50 x 1080p 60 fps 100 x 1080p 30 fps 200 x 720p 400 x SD |
SVC Ports | 400 x 1080P | 600 x 1080P | 600 x 1080P |
Hot Spares | Power supplies, network ports, fans, and MCU. | ||
Standards and Protocols | ITU-T H.323, IETF SIP | ||
Video Features |
Video resolution: 1080p 60 fps, 1080p 30 fps, 720p 60 fps, 720p 30 fps, 4CIF, CIF. Presentation/Data resolution: 4K, 1080p, 720p, 4CIF, CIF, SXGA, SVGA, XGA, WXGA, WXGA+, SXGA+, UXGA+, WUXGA+. |
||
Audio Features |
G.711a, G.711u, G.719, G.722, G.722.1, G.722.1C, G.729, G.729A, iLBC, Opus, AAC-LD. Supports single/dual/triple audio channels, sound localization, and wideband audio mixing. |
||
Conferencing Features |
AVC universal transcoding conferencing, SVC multi-stream forwarding conferencing, or conferencing that supports both modes. Video conferencing, data conferencing, or hybrid conferencing. Conference cascading of up to five levels, and support for SVC multi-stream cascading and dynamic multi-channel cascading. Voice activation, continuous presence per port, automatic continuous presence (25 panes at most, special on-table mode for triple-screen telepresence participants), and up to 64 layouts for automatic and manual continuous presence. SiteCall, call by URI and IP address, audiovisual IVR, ad hoc conference, or VMR, and unified access number. |
